Mirrorless cameras are great for vloggers wanting a powerful camera without the weight and size of a DSLR camera. As mirrorless cameras are becoming better with all the advancements in camera technology, more and more DSLR camera vloggers are switching over to vlogging with a mirrorless camera. Below is our list and review of the eight best mirrorless cameras for vlogging.
WHAT TO LOOK FOR IN A VLOGGING CAMERA
1. Fully articulated screen (flip screen)
2. Good continual autofocus while recording video
3. Good focus priority through face recognition
4. Touch to focus
5. Good low-light performance
6. external mic jack, hot/cold shoe bracket
7. optical image stabilization
8. good battery life

Best daily mirrorless camera for vlogging: Canon EOS M50 The Canon EOS M50 is Canon’s first mirrorless camera that comes equipped with both a fully-articulated screen and an external microphone jack. It came out only a few months ago and is already considered one of the best mirrorless cameras for vlogging. The M50 is also the only camera on our list that you can buy at a prosumer’s budget that shoots 4K video. Yes, the Sony a7R III and Panasonic GH5S also shoot 4K video, but they are much more expensive. With Canon’s new DIGIC 8 Image Processor, the camera’s dual-pixel autofocusing system will perform even better. PROS - Can shoot UHD 4K videos at 23.98 fps - Has a 2.36m-dot OLED electronic viewfinder CONS - No image stabilization - Battery life could be longer |

Best entry-level mirrorless camera for vlogging: Canon EOS M100 The Canon EOS M100 is a small, but powerful mirrorless camera for vlogging. This camera can shoot full HD 1080p videos at 60 fps. It cannot shoot 4K video, unfortunately. It uses its DIGIC 7 Image Processor and dual-pixel autofocusing system to ensure that your vlogs are always in focus. The M100 provides great ISO sensitivity options - it can reach up to ISO 25600. With its built-in Wi-Fi with NFC, you can transfer your media seamlessly to a computer. PROS - Affordable - Great connectivity options CONS - Lacks advanced video recording features - No viewfinder |

Best professional mirrorless camera for vlogging: Panasonic Lumix DC-GH5S Originally, Panasonic had released it’s GH5 as a hybrid camera that handles both photography and videography well. In response to hearing customers’ interest in a more video-focused camera, Panasonic came up with the GH5S. In our list of the top mirrorless cameras, the Panasonic GH5S and the Sony a7R III are the two professional mirrorless cameras that can record 4K video. Between the two, though, the GH5S wins as the best professional mirrorless camera for vlogging because it sports a fully-articulated screen. Its micro four-thirds sensor is smaller than the a7R III’s full-frame sensor. Even with a smaller sensor, though, the GH5S is made to still autofocus well in low lighting conditions. Another amazing feature is its ability to record 240 fps slow-motion video at full HD 1080p. PROS - ISO sensitivity goes up to 204800 - High video bit rates CONS - Expensive - The camera body weighs about 1.5 lbs |

As a YouTube video creator, especially a YouTube beauty, you must know how important video color correction is. In case you want to make your YouTube video look more vibrant or pop out the colors of your video, knowing the basics of video color correction will certainly help you. Color correction with Wondershare Filmora
Wondershare Filmora can be used to adjust the color of your video. To do this, select your target video and drag it to the timeline. You will see a video editing window and four parameters i.e. Saturation, brightness, contrast, and hue.
Brightness settings can be used to adjust the overall look of your video. In case your video seems to be too dark or bright, you can take the cursor to the slider and adjust the color manually.
Saturation helps you control how much you want the color of your video pop out. The color can be faded or enhanced through this setting.
Contrast settings help to adjust the difference in color and brightness in different parts of the video.
Color grading with Wondershare Filmora
Hit the button Advanced at the lower corner, then a powerful color grading window will pop up, and you can explore your options.
In this tool, you can adjust the white balance, temperature, tint, and more.

3. By Using Final Cut Pro
Final Cut Pro lets you adjust your video color with the help of a tool called the Color Board. There are a lot of tools available in The Color section for adjusting the color of your video clip. The first option is of “Balance” which lets you alter the brightness of video. You can also try the option of “Match Color” which lets you match one video clip’s color settings with another. You can be as creative as you want to be by adjusting the brightness, saturation and RGB values of your video with this software. It will not disappoint with the outstanding output.
